What is WordPress Blockquote
A blockquote in WordPress is a specific HTML element designed for displaying quotes from other sources. It sets this text apart from the main content, making it visually distinct and easier to read. Typically, blockquotes are indented and styled differently than the surrounding text, often incorporating citations to credit the original author. You can use them for quotes from authors, notable figures, or even to emphasize a point within your content.
How to Add a Blockquote in WordPress
Adding a blockquote in WordPress is straightforward. Here’s how:
-
Open the post or page where you want to add the blockquote.
-
In the block editor, click the “+” icon to add a new block.
-
Search for “Quote” or select it from the formatting options.
-
Enter your quote text and the author’s name if applicable.
Voila! You’ve successfully added a blockquote to your content. Right away, you’ll notice it enhances your content’s visual appeal and readability.

Tips for Using WordPress Blockquote Effectively
To maximize the impact of your blockquotes, consider the following tips:
Keep It Short and Relevant
While blockquotes are impactful, overly lengthy quotes can overwhelm readers. Aim for concise quotes that contribute meaningfully to your content.
Use Proper Attribution
Citing the source of your quote is essential for credibility. Always provide the author’s name and, if relevant, the source link to give proper credit.
Style It to Match Your Branding
WordPress allows you to customize blockquotes to fit your site’s branding. Using CSS, you can change colors, fonts, and other style elements to make it feel cohesive.
Pair Blockquotes with Related Content
Consider linking to other posts or pages on your website when using blockquotes. For example, if you quote an expert, you might link to an in-depth article about their work, leading to better internal linking and SEO.
